2012-04-28 17 views
9

He estado trabajando en este servidor durante todo el semestre y no he cambiado las opciones de configuración; los directorios/archivos que creé hace un par de semanas todavía son accesibles, sin embargo, ningún directorio nuevo, incluso el duplicado exacto de los viejos directorios de trabajo déjame acceder a ellos - obtengo el error "Directorio indexado prohibido por la directiva Options". ¿Qué está causando esto?Error - Índice de directorio prohibido por la directiva Options?

Respuesta

32

Parece que alguien ha desactivado la lista de directorios en Apache. Si se le permite anularlo con .htaccess basta con colocar un archivo .htaccess en su directorio web raíz con esta información:

Options +Indexes 
3

Para mí esto fue un problema con no simplemente tener un index.html o index.php (según lo que está en el archivo .htaccess) en una carpeta e intentando extraer sus contenidos. Entonces otra vez estaba usando php para leer contenido, no por línea de comando como supongo que eres. Si aún no ha encontrado una solución intente crear un índice. (Php, html) en el directorio del que no puede extraer contenido.

0

Para mí trabajó en Wordpress. Error al acceso prohibido wp-admin. Creé .htaccess con opciones + contenido de índices.

Gracias.

1

Para mí, lo que me ayudó fue seguir las explicaciones en el archivo httpd.conf y asegurarme de que cumplo. El comentario más abajo ayudó:

# The path to the end user account 'public_html' directory must be 
# accessible to the webserver userid. This usually means that ~userid 
# must have permissions of 711, ~userid/public_html must have permissions 
# of 755, and documents contained therein must be world-readable. 
# Otherwise, the client will only receive a "403 Forbidden" message. 

yo estaba tratando de mover la raíz del documento y no había puesto las ondulaciones permanentes derecha ..

Cuestiones relacionadas